Before Calling for Service
OVEN TEMPERATURE TOO HIGH OR
TOO LOW
Was the oven preheated?
Push in and rotate the Temperature knob to the desired
setting and let the oven preheat until it reaches the
temperature before you begin cooking.
Are the racks positioned properly?
See pages 31 to 32 for rack positioning.
Is there proper air circulation around bakeware?
If bakeware takes up too much room, air circulation will
be reduced.
Is the batter evenly distributed in the pan?
Check that batter is level in the pan when baking.
Is the proper length of time being used?
Make sure proper cooking time was used.

THE FLAME GOES OUT ONCE
RELEASING THE KNOB
Safety valve - Knob not pressed down long enough.
Press and turn the knob again and hold down three
to ve seconds after the burner has been lit. This is a
safety feature.
BURNER WON’T IGNITE OR BURNS
UNEVENLY
Gas valve - The valve is not open.
Make sure the valve is completely open.

Burner cap issues.
The burner cap is not placed correctly; replace the
burner cap. Some holes in the lid are blocked; clean the
holes of the lid.
Spark pin - The spark pin is wet or contaminated by
the food.
Clean and dry the spark pin.
Gas connecting pipes - The gas connecting pipes
are blocked or pinched.
Contact a qualied technician. Adjust or change the
connecting pipes.
